Kathleen Denis – From Vibrant Colors to Beautiful Greys: Using a Limited Palette of Six Colors (Online Class Recording)

Date recorded: Friday, March 29, 2024
Medium: All (Kathleen works in oil)

Discover how to achieve the vibrant colors you desire for an exciting painting, along with the supporting greys that enhance your scene, using just 6 specific colors plus white for endless hues, tints, shades and tones.  With this knowledge you will rid the frustration of not knowing what colors to mix by understanding what is in these 6 pigments.  How freeing to not have to buy every color made!  Kathleen will explain in-detail why these particular colors make every hue and will demonstrate how to mix and use them for your desired palette.  She will also explain how you can use additional colors effectively by knowing where they fall on a color wheel.  Learning this information allows for not only easier mixing but also easier travel with fewer tubes of paint.

All artistic levels are welcome.

Artists using any medium can learn from these principles, but Kathleen will be demonstrating in oils.

Kathleen Denis is known for capturing sun-drenched light in her contemporary-impressionistic style paintings, whether painting scenes of island life, timeworn cottages, inviting gardens or adorable doggies. Presently living in Palm Beach Shores, she was born in Miami, grew up in Ft. Lauderdale, and spent much time in the Florida Keys and the Bahamas, which greatly influenced her use of subject matter and colorful style.

Kathleen’s love of art began with lessons at the age of four, and graduated from University of Miami, with a BFA degree in Graphic Design, while continuing to passionately study, paint en plein air and studio, teach, and win awards.

Her art is licensed by leading manufacturers worldwide and found on numerous home décor and gift products, found at stores such as HomeGoods and Bed, Bath & Beyond. Her original paintings are acquired in galleries, exhibits, plein air events and on her website at www.kathleendenis.com.
